IA y desarrollo de software

Topic sobre cómo la IA transforma el trabajo de ingeniería: qué delega, qué privilegia, qué diferencia. Tesis triangulada desde CEO (Rauch), ingeniero en trincheras (Atsushi) y análisis de habilidades (tech-skills).

Tesis actual

El código pasa de ser input a ser output. El desarrollador pasa de tipeador de sintaxis a arquitecto y director de prompts. La IA democratiza el desarrollo → más gente crea software → calidad, diseño y simplicidad se vuelven los diferenciadores escasos.

Las tres eras de la web (Rauch)

EraCaracterística
EstáticaHTML desde CDN
DinámicaPersonalizada (Amazon)
GenerativaUI producida por ML en tiempo real ← estamos aquí

Qué delega la IA

  • Sintaxis y APIs.
  • Código boilerplate.
  • Configuración de entorno (Replit, Vercel).

Qué privilegia

  • Arquitectura y diseño de sistemas.
  • Ingeniería de prompts.
  • Calidad, diseño, simplicidad.
  • Ética y gobernanza de datos.

Tensiones no resueltas

  1. ¿Quién aplica principios-software (SOLID, etc.) al código generado? ¿Se verifica post-hoc? ¿La IA los aplica? Ninguna fuente actual responde.
  2. Seguridad de LLMs (grandma-exploit) — democratizar también democratiza el abuso.
  3. Calidad como diferenciador suena bien, pero no hay métricas concretas en las fuentes.
  4. comprehension-debt — primera fuente con números concretos del costo cognitivo de la asistencia IA (RCT Anthropic enero 2026: −17pp en comprensión, debugging es el skill más golpeado, inquiry mode preserva retención mientras delegation mode la destruye). Cierra parcialmente la tensión #3: el diferenciador escaso no es solo calidad del código, sino grip arquitectónico del autor sobre lo que envía.

Cruces

  • principios-software — hay tensión: simplicidad de Rauch ≈ “mejor código es el que no escribes” (Brian/Enzo).
  • marketing-emprendimiento — Rauch e Isra Bravo coinciden: en mercados saturados, lo escaso es autenticidad/calidad.
  • apps-mobile-b2c — el cluster mobile del usuario es aplicación específica del stack AI-first a productos consumer (3 de 4 brainstorms tienen capa IA: Mística, Creator Business Tool, AI Photo).
  • agentes-ia-arquitectura ⭐ (topic hermano nuevo, mayo 2026) — “developer × IA” (este topic) vs “construir agentes IA” (el nuevo). Overlap en vibe-coding, comprehension-debt, mcp-protocol.
  • automatizacion-no-code-empresarial ⭐ (topic hermano nuevo, mayo 2026) — “developer × IA” (este topic) vs “operador no-código × IA para automatizar negocio” (el nuevo). Operador distinto, dominio distinto, stack base solapado (vibe coding + Lovable/v0/Cursor + APIs IA). El cluster Modo Inteligente alimenta ambos topics.

Refuerzo masivo — batch inbox digests (mayo 2026)

inbox-2026-05-ai-coding-claude-agregada aporta 4-5 voces editoriales nuevas convergentes:

  • Claude Code/OpenClaw como infraestructura, no IDE (emerging-ai 2026-05-13 + bytebytego EP214 2026-05-10).
  • Karpathy second brain ya es mainstream 2026 — confirma que la tesis del propio wiki ya no es nicho experimental (emerging-ai continued + guide).
  • “AI amplifica seniors, daña juniors” (Strategize Career 2026-04-29) — frame nuevo sobre asimetría que aumenta spread en lugar de cerrarlo.
  • Code review como nuevo DORA metric (Engineering Leadership 2026-05-14) — “smaller PRs es el lever de mayor impacto”.
  • Developer taste como skill no-replazable (Strategize 2026-05-07) — “la IA amplifica el gusto pero no lo genera”.
  • AI Onboarding a codebase (Engineering Leadership 2026-05-11) — procedimiento operativo del inquiry mode aplicado a codebase nuevo, cierre parcial de pregunta abierta de comprehension-debt.

inbox-2026-05-ai-industria-modelos-agregada aporta la dimensión macro/geopolítica que contextualiza:

  • Benchmark wars terminaron — la pelea es plataforma (enterprise lock-in) y compute, no modelo.
  • $700B AI bet Google + Amazon + Meta capex Q1 2026.
  • Electricidad > chips como bottleneck emergente 2026-2027.
  • China ya superó a EE.UU. en consumo real de tokens y descargas de Hugging Face.
  • iOS abriéndose a Claude/Gemini = poder se transfiere de Apple a proveedores de modelos.

Tercera ola — AI Engineer Conference 2025

ai-engineer-coding-modelos-agregada documenta la maduración del paradigma:

  • Curva vibe coding → vibe engineering. Karpathy acuña, Pocock + Horthy + O’Leary maduran. Fase “yolo vibes” ya superada en discurso de industria.
  • Patrones operativos canónicos: RPI (Research/Plan/Implement), TDD con agentes, Ralph Loops, humano como mánager + revisor.
  • Repos agent-legible: módulos profundos, agents.md/claude.md/.cursorrules en raíz, APIs/CLIs sobre GUIs, shift left.
  • Specs to Code formalizado — EARS + Property-Based Testing (Kiro/Kuro), Backlog.md, cortes verticales (Matt Pocock). Con advertencia explícita: la versión extrema produce entropía.
  • Sandboxing como first-class — V8 Isolates, Seatbelt/seccomp+landlock, Default Deny + capabilities mínimas, proxy para secretos.
  • dspy-gepa como concept nuevo — el fin del prompt engineering manual, especialmente para calibrar llm-as-judge.
  • RL con recompensas verificables — GRPO (DeepSeek), Agent RFT (OpenAI), RLAIF. Casos: Devin 2.0 (10→4 pasos), OpenPipe ART E (Qwen 14B supera a o3 en correo), Makro (+72% sobre SOTA con 100 prompts).
  • SLMs especializados + test-time scaling — Gemma E2B/E4B PLE en Flash; un 8B iguala razonamiento de GPT-4 con costo bajo.

Cuarta voz convergente sobre comprehension-debt vía “vibe coding hangover” como síntoma observable del mismo problema (después de Osmani, Substack Weekly Stack y Strategize Career).

Fuentes contribuyentes

Conceptos centrales

vibe-coding · comprehension-debt · context-engineering · agentic-ai · principios-software (cruzado) · mcp-protocol (vía cluster agentes) · agentic-patterns (vía cluster agentes)

Entidades centrales

guillermo-rauch · bytebytego · emerging-ai · kent-beck · system-design-one

Potenciales fuentes futuras

  • Andrej Karpathy sobre software 2.0/3.0 (ausente).
  • Simon Willison sobre LLMs aplicados (ausente).
  • Casos reales de equipos usando vibe coding en producción (ausentes).

Ideas de contenido derivadas

  • Post “Las 3 eras de la web según Rauch — y por qué ahora la calidad importa MÁS” — síntesis de vibe-c-vercel-rauch + cruce con Isra Bravo (isra-bravo-copywriting): dos voces, dos mercados, misma conclusión sobre diferenciación por autenticidad/calidad.
  • Post o video “Código como output, no como input” — la frase de Rauch tiene potencial de hook. Reformular qué significa para la carrera del developer promedio (no Rauch).
  • Hilo “Lo que NO cubre el hype de vibe coding” — usar grandma-exploit + tensión identificada en principios-software (¿quién aplica SOLID al código generado?) + gaps de vibe-coding-101-replit. Tono crítico, contraste con el optimismo dominante.
  • Post propio “Comprehension debt — la deuda invisible que acelera al equipo justo antes de que algo explote” — destilar comprehension-debt al perfil LATAM/freelance del usuario: traducir los hallazgos del RCT Anthropic + experimento accidental del autor a una rutina semanal de “inquiry default” para developers que viven de Cursor/Claude Code. Cruce natural con bc-1-ai-tools-developers y bc-6-estado-ai-2025 del corpus propio.
  • Newsletter “El test del lunes” (Break the Code idea) — la regla “puedo contestar sobre mi código sin abrir la chat window al menos la mitad del tiempo” como ritual operativo semanal. Hook accionable, sin teoría, fácil de aplicar.